When sourcing finished textiles from ASEAN factories—especially those running stenters (tenter frames) for drying and heat-setting—overseas buyers often focus on fabric quality and price, but overlook the critical environmental and mechanical systems that keep production running. The exhaust gas treatment system for stenters, including oil mist purification and fan maintenance, is not just a regulatory checkbox. It directly affects production uptime, product consistency, and your compliance risk as an importer. In Vietnam, Indonesia, Thailand, and Malaysia, local environmental regulations are tightening, and a poorly maintained exhaust system can lead to factory shutdowns, delayed shipments, or even penalties that disrupt your supply chain.

For B2B buyers, understanding how ASEAN suppliers manage their stenter exhaust gas is a practical due diligence step. The system typically includes an exhaust hood, ductwork, a primary oil mist collector (often using electrostatic precipitators or centrifugal separators), a secondary scrubber or activated carbon filter, and the induced draft fan that moves the air. The fan is the heart of the system—if it fails, the stenter cannot operate. Regular maintenance of fan blades, bearings, and vibration levels is essential. When you audit a potential supplier, ask about their preventive maintenance schedule, spare parts inventory, and whether they use OEM or reputable aftermarket parts. Also, check if they monitor pressure differentials across filters, as high pressure drop means clogged filters and reduced airflow, which affects drying uniformity and fabric quality.

From a sourcing and compliance perspective, you should also verify that the supplier’s exhaust gas treatment meets the standards of your destination country. For example, if you import to the EU, you must ensure that the factory can provide test reports for volatile organic compounds (VOCs), particulate matter, and oil mist emissions. In the US, OSHA and EPA guidelines may apply. In ASEAN, local regulations vary—Vietnam’s QCVN 19:2009/BTNMT and Indonesia’s environmental standards are common benchmarks. Request a copy of the factory’s most recent emission test report, and if possible, have an independent third-party inspector verify the system during your pre-shipment inspection. Also, consider the logistics of any after-sales service: if you are importing machinery or spare parts for the exhaust system, clarify Incoterms, lead times, and whether the supplier can support remote troubleshooting or local service in your region.

AspectWhat to CheckTypical ASEAN Compliance / Best PracticeBuyer Action
Emission LimitsVOCs, oil mist, particulate matter (PM)Vietnam QCVN 19, Thailand PCD, Indonesia KLHKRequest latest stack test report; verify limits against your country’s rules
Oil Mist Purification TechnologyElectrostatic precipitator (ESP), centrifugal, or wet scrubberESP is common for high-efficiency oil mist removal (>95%)Ask for efficiency specifications and maintenance log
Fan MaintenanceBearing lubrication, belt tension, vibration, blade cleaningPreventive maintenance every 500–1000 operating hoursInclude fan inspection in your factory audit checklist
Spare Parts & Local SupportAvailability of filters, electrodes, fan belts, bearingsSuppliers often stock generic parts; OEM parts may take 2-4 weeksNegotiate spare parts package and service SLAs
Supplier DocumentationISO 14001, local environmental permits, test reportsISO 14001 is common, but verify actual complianceRequest copies and cross-check validity

When selecting a supplier, look for factories that have invested in reputable exhaust gas treatment brands—for example, companies like Keller Lufttechnik, W.L. Gore (for filter bags), or local ASEAN brands that specialize in electrostatic oil mist collectors. However, be cautious: many factories use locally fabricated systems with generic components. While these can be effective, you need to verify their performance data. A practical approach is to ask for a video of the system running and the fan amperage readings during peak production. Also, ask about their waste oil disposal—proper handling of collected oil is a sign of a responsible factory.

For logistics, if you are importing the entire stenter or exhaust system, consider the import duties and customs clearance in your country. Many ASEAN countries have export incentives for machinery, but you should confirm the HS code and any certifications required (e.g., CE marking for EU). Also, plan for installation and commissioning: ensure the supplier provides detailed manuals and maybe remote support. If you are sourcing textiles from a factory that already has the system in place, you can focus on the operational reliability. In that case, request a maintenance history and ask about any recent downtime due to exhaust fan failure. This will give you insight into the factory’s reliability.
